M.H.C. Law is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ition and Signal Processing.
According to data from OpenAlex, M.H.C. Law has authored 7 papers receiving a total of 810 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Artificial Intelligence, 3 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ition and 2 papers in Signal Processing. Recurrent topics in M.H.C. Law’s work include Bayesian Methods and Mixture Models (4 papers), Advanced Clustering Algorithms Research (4 papers) and Data Management and Algorithms (2 papers). M.H.C. Law is often cited by papers focused on Bayesian Methods and Mixture Models (4 papers), Advanced Clustering Algorithms Research (4 papers) and Data Management and Algorithms (2 papers). M.H.C. Law collaborates with scholars based in United States, Switzerland and Portugal. M.H.C. Law's co-authors include Anil K. Jain, James T. Kwok, Joachim M. Buhmann, Mário A. T. Figueiredo and A. Topchy and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Transactions on Pattern Analysis and Machine Intelligence and Decision Support Systems.
